/* Any copyright is dedicated to the Public Domain.
*/
// Tests that extensions installed through the registry work as expected
createAppInfo("xpcshell@tests.mozilla.org", "XPCShell", "1", "1.9.2");
// Enable loading extensions from the user and system scopes
Services.prefs.setIntPref(
"extensions.enabledScopes",
AddonManager.SCOPE_PROFILE +
AddonManager.SCOPE_USER +
AddonManager.SCOPE_SYSTEM
);
Services.prefs.setIntPref("extensions.sideloadScopes", AddonManager.SCOPE_ALL);
const ID1 = "addon1@tests.mozilla.org";
const ID2 = "addon2@tests.mozilla.org";
let xpi1, xpi2;
let registry;
add_task(async function setup() {
xpi1 = await createTempWebExtensionFile({
manifest: { browser_specific_settings: { gecko: { id: ID1 } } },
});
xpi2 = await createTempWebExtensionFile({
manifest: { browser_specific_settings: { gecko: { id: ID2 } } },
});
registry = new MockRegistry();
registerCleanupFunction(() => {
registry.shutdown();
});
});
// Tests whether basic registry install works
add_task(async function test_1() {
registry.setValue(
Ci.nsIWindowsRegKey.ROOT_KEY_LOCAL_MACHINE,
"SOFTWARE\\Mozilla\\XPCShell\\Extensions",
ID1,
xpi1.path
);
registry.setValue(
Ci.nsIWindowsRegKey.ROOT_KEY_CURRENT_USER,
"SOFTWARE\\Mozilla\\XPCShell\\Extensions",
ID2,
xpi2.path
);
await promiseStartupManager();
let [a1, a2] = await AddonManager.getAddonsByIDs([ID1, ID2]);
notEqual(a1, null);
ok(a1.isActive);
ok(!hasFlag(a1.permissions, AddonManager.PERM_CAN_UNINSTALL));
equal(a1.scope, AddonManager.SCOPE_SYSTEM);
notEqual(a2, null);
ok(a2.isActive);
ok(!hasFlag(a2.permissions, AddonManager.PERM_CAN_UNINSTALL));
equal(a2.scope, AddonManager.SCOPE_USER);
});
// Tests whether uninstalling from the registry works
add_task(async function test_2() {
registry.setValue(
Ci.nsIWindowsRegKey.ROOT_KEY_LOCAL_MACHINE,
"SOFTWARE\\Mozilla\\XPCShell\\Extensions",
ID1,
null
);
registry.setValue(
Ci.nsIWindowsRegKey.ROOT_KEY_CURRENT_USER,
"SOFTWARE\\Mozilla\\XPCShell\\Extensions",
ID2,
null
);
await promiseRestartManager();
let [a1, a2] = await AddonManager.getAddonsByIDs([ID1, ID2]);
equal(a1, null);
equal(a2, null);
});
